The global recombinant protein market was valued at USD 1.9 billion in 2023, driven by the increasing demand for effective drugs to treat chronic diseases across the globe. The market is expected to grow at a CAGR of 11.21% during the forecast period of 2024 and 2032, likely to attain a value of USD 4.94 billion by 2032.

Global Recombinant Protein Market Analysis

The global recombinant protein market has witnessed significant growth over the past few years, driven by advancements in biotechnology and increasing demand for therapeutic proteins. Recombinant proteins are produced through recombinant DNA technology, allowing for the production of proteins in large quantities and with high purity. These proteins are used extensively in various fields, including medical research, diagnostics, and therapeutics, as well as in agricultural and industrial applications.

Market Drivers

One of the primary drivers of the recombinant protein market is the growing prevalence of chronic diseases such as cancer, diabetes, and autoimmune disorders. Recombinant proteins play a crucial role in the development of biopharmaceuticals that target these conditions, offering more effective and personalised treatment options. The rise in the geriatric population, which is more susceptible to chronic illnesses, further fuels this demand.

Technological advancements in protein expression systems and bioprocessing techniques have significantly enhanced the efficiency and scalability of recombinant protein production. These innovations reduce production costs and improve the quality of the final product, making recombinant proteins more accessible for various applications.
Another critical driver is the increasing investment in research and development (R&D) activities by biopharmaceutical companies and research institutions. This investment is aimed at discovering new therapeutic proteins and improving existing ones, contributing to the expansion of the market.

Challenges

Despite the growth prospects, the recombinant protein market faces several challenges. One of the main challenges is the high cost associated with the production and purification of recombinant proteins. The complexity of the production process and the need for specialised equipment and facilities contribute to these costs, which can limit market growth, especially in developing regions.

Regulatory hurdles also pose a significant challenge. The stringent regulatory requirements for the approval of recombinant protein products can delay their market entry and increase development costs. Companies must navigate these regulations carefully to ensure compliance while maintaining the pace of innovation.
Additionally, the risk of immunogenicity, where the body's immune system reacts against the therapeutic protein, remains a concern. This can lead to adverse effects and reduce the efficacy of the treatment, posing a challenge for the widespread adoption of recombinant protein therapies.

Future Opportunities

The future of the recombinant protein market looks promising, with several opportunities on the horizon. The development of novel expression systems, such as cell-free protein synthesis and synthetic biology approaches, holds the potential to revolutionise recombinant protein production. These technologies offer faster and more cost-effective production methods, which can help overcome current challenges.

The increasing focus on personalised medicine is another significant opportunity. Recombinant proteins can be tailored to individual patients' needs, enhancing the effectiveness of treatments and minimising side effects. This personalised approach is expected to drive the demand for recombinant proteins in the coming years.
Emerging markets, particularly in Asia-Pacific and Latin America, present substantial growth opportunities. These regions are experiencing rising healthcare expenditures and improving biopharmaceutical infrastructure, creating a favourable environment for the expansion of the recombinant protein market.

Furthermore, the growing application of recombinant proteins in the agricultural and industrial sectors, such as in the production of enzymes for biofuels and biodegradable plastics, is expected to open new avenues for market growth.
